Output ec943fea08abc2ff9600fb1373972144917a68e4ce5df8f7cea9ff604183b076:1

value
503367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8fee7ba8a41d3a5188caf5ec450d611ab495453 OP_EQUAL
address
3JZBcxqzrcix7ayRuTRZ79if1sJTV2Ukn9
transaction
ec943fea08abc2ff9600fb1373972144917a68e4ce5df8f7cea9ff604183b076
spent
true